What is Orange Pi Software?

Orange Pi software refers to the various operating systems and development environments specifically designed for Orange Pi devices. These range from lightweight Linux distributions to advanced tools for creating and managing applications. The primary goal of Orange Pi software is to provide users with a customizable and efficient environment for programming, prototyping, and building IoT solutions.

Transitioning from basic SBC functionalities, Orange Pi software can be adapted for complex operations, offering flexibility in both personal and professional projects.

Top Operating Systems for Orange Pi

  1. Orange Pi OS:

    A customized version of Linux, Orange Pi OS is optimized for Orange Pi devices. It offers a lightweight yet powerful environment, perfect for users who need a stable OS for development and day-to-day tasks.
  2. Armbian:

    A community-driven operating system, Armbian is known for its stability and support for SBCs like Orange Pi. It’s ideal for developers looking for an optimized OS that offers a balance between performance and flexibility.
  3. Android:

    For those looking to use their Orange Pi for multimedia purposes, Android is a solid option. Orange Pi supports versions of Android that allow users to turn their SBC into a media center, smart device, or even a gaming platform.

Why Choose Orange Pi Software?

The software ecosystem surrounding Orange Pi provides users with an incredible range of options, catering to various needs:

  • Open Source Flexibility:

    Most of the operating systems and development tools for Orange Pi are open-source, meaning they are constantly being updated and improved by a passionate community of developers. This allows users to customize and tweak their OS to meet specific project requirements.
  • Development Tools:

    Orange Pi software supports a variety of programming languages and development environments, including Python, C, and Java. These tools make it easier for developers to prototype and deploy projects efficiently.
  • IoT and Smart Projects:

    Orange Pi’s software environment is ideal for building Internet of Things (IoT) projects. With compatibility for platforms like Node-RED and Home Assistant, it becomes an excellent hub for smart home devices, sensors, and automated solutions.

How to Get Started with Orange Pi Software

Setting up your Orange Pi with the right software is easy. Here’s a quick guide to get you started:

  1. Download the OS:
    Choose the operating system that best suits your project from the Orange Pi official website or a trusted repository like Armbian.

  2. Flash the Image:
    Use a tool like Balena Etcher to flash the OS image onto your microSD card.

  3. Insert and Boot:
    Insert the microSD card into your Orange Pi, connect it to a monitor, keyboard, and power source, and boot it up!

  4. Start Developing:
    Once your OS is running, you can start installing development tools and libraries. You’re now ready to begin programming and prototyping!
